Roles And Responsibilities:

  • Picking Customer Orders
  • Packing Customer Orders
  • Maintaining a clean and safe working area
  • Meeting daily processing targets while maintaining accuracy
  • Perform other duties as required – flexibility and willingness to learn new skills are beneficial

About You:

You will be a UK resident and able to travel to and from the site for your shift. Visa assistance and relocation support are not available. You will have excellent attention to detail, be able to identify faults and product conditions, and be comfortable working on your feet for long periods. You will need basic IT skills (scanners / warehouse systems) and the ability to follow processes and quality standards. How to prepare for a job interview at TipTopJob

Know the Role Inside Out

Before your interview, make sure you understand the responsibilities of a Warehouse Operative. Familiarise yourself with picking and packing processes, as well as the importance of accuracy and attention to detail. This will show that you're genuinely interested in the role.

Show Off Your Organisational Skills

Since the job requires excellent organisational skills, think of examples from your past experiences where you've demonstrated this. Whether it's managing tasks at school or keeping your room tidy, be ready to share how you keep things in order.

Be Ready for Practical Questions

Expect questions about how you would handle specific situations in the warehouse. For instance, they might ask how you'd deal with a mistake in an order. Think through these scenarios beforehand so you can respond confidently and show your problem-solving skills.

Ask Questions About Training and Development

Since the company offers full on-the-job training and upskilling opportunities, prepare some questions about these aspects. This not only shows your eagerness to learn but also helps you gauge how the company supports its employees' growth.
